Chapter 14 Note If your ID has the restricted options, the following messages appear on the LCD. Message Meaning Access Denied Printing documents directly from the USB flash memory drive to the Brother machine is restricted. Limit Exceeded The number of pages you are allowed to print is exceeded. The print job will be canceled. No Permission Printing color documents is restricted. The print job will be canceled. Mono Print Only Printing color documents is restricted. Press Black Start or Color Start to print the data. • File names containing more than 8 characters will appear on the LCD as the first 6 characters of the file name followed by a tilde mark (~) and a number. For example, "HOLIDAY2007.JPG" would appear as "HOLIDA~1.JPG".
